By now you know that【C1】______your money’s worth is not just a matter of luck. It is more often the【C2】 ______ of buying skill【C3】______, even the smartest consumers are sometimes fooled into thinking they are getting their money’s worth【C4】______they are not. At one time or another, almost everyone experiences deception in the market place. The deception may not be【C5】______But, intentional or not any kind of deception【C6】______consumer’s pocket books. Some kinds endanger their health and safety as well【C7】______, consumers need protection against the marketing of unsafe goods and false or misleading advertising. Fortunately, there are both public and【C8】______agencies working to meet the need.
Government’s job in free enterprise system is to protect the public interest. The public is【C9】______entirely of consumers. When it【C10】______to protecting consumers, therefore, government has the【C11】______influence.【C12】______most consumer products are sold【C13】______, the major responsibility for consumer protection is【C14】______by the federal government. That responsibility, however, is【C15】______by many agencies. For example, the US Postal Service works to uncover and stop dishonest【C16】______operated by mail. The National Highway Safety Bureau is【C17】______with all aspects of automobile safety. Certain federal agencies, however, have consumer protection as one of their chief purposes. Four of these are described below.
Most federal agencies are known【C18】______their initials. FDA stands for the Food and Drug Administration, which probably does more to protect consumers than any other agency. Its major concern is the safety, purity, and labelling of【C19】______, drugs, and cosmetics. These are the products【C20】______which consumers spend an estimated 38% of their incomes.
【C14】
选项
A、assured
B、assumed
C、ensured
D、insured
答案
B
解析
C.ensure保证,为及物动词,如:ensure his safety保证他的安全。A.assure使……放心,必须用于assure sb.of/that结构中。B.assume假设;承担,如:assume one’s duties承担义务。D.insure给……保险。此处动词的主语是“responsibility”,用assume搭配是合适,表示“承担责任”。
